Golfing Tradition at Girton Golf Club
Girton Golf Club, established in 1894 by a group of local golfers, is one of the oldest courses in the region. Located just a few miles from Cambridge, this club integrates rich history with vibrant golfing culture.
The course features an 18-hole layout designed by Harry Colt, renowned for its challenging holes and exceptional maintenance. The natural surroundings, including mature trees and wildlife, enhance the golfing experience, making it a favorite among players.
